Siauliai vs Smara Climate & Distance Between

Western Sahara flag
  • The distance between Siauliai, Lithuania and Smara, Western Sahara is approximately 4,272 km or 2,655 mi.
  • To reach Siauliai in this distance one would set out from Smara bearing 31°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Siauliai bearing 55.2° or NE .
  • Siauliai has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Smara has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Siauliai is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Smara is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 16.7 °C (30°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.8 °C (12.2°F) more in Siauliai.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 462 mm (18.2 in) more which is equivalent to 462 l/m² (11.34 US gal/ft²) or 4,620,000 l/ha (493,909 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 29.1° lower in Siauliai than in Smara.
